モデル内の各項目をループして、いくつかのプロパティの名前とデータを表示します。これはうまくいきます。
@foreach (var item in Model)
{
<div class="Ticket">
<h3>
@item.Title
</h3>
@Html.DisplayNameFor(model => model.DateCreated)
@Html.DisplayFor(modelItem => item.DateCreated)
モデルには書式設定の手がかりを提供する関連付けられた DataAnnotation があるため、これは最終的に「Created 1/1/1」のような出力になります。これまでのところ良い。
私がやりたいことは、エンティティ フレームワークを介してモデルに関連付けられているアイテムの [フォーマットされた] 名前を表示することです。コードを使用してデータパラメーターを表示できます...
@Html.DisplayFor(modelItem => item.LinkedEntity.Data)
しかし、関連するラベルを表示するための構文を理解できません。何か案は?